Nippy Egg and Cheese Buns

ingredients
- 2 cups grated sharp cheddar cheese
- 1 (4 1/2 ounce) can chopped ripe olives
- 4 green onions, thinly sliced
- 1⁄2 red pepper, seeded and finely chopped
- 4 whole wheat English muffins, split
- 2 hard-cooked eggs, chopped
- 2 tablespoons catsup
- 2 teaspoons prepared mustard
directions
- Preheat broiler. Mix cheese, olives, red or green pepper, onions, eggs, catsup and mustard until well combined.
- Arrange buttered English muffins on a baking sheet and broil until cut sides are slightly browned. Remove from oven and divide egg mixture evenly among the 8 muffin halves, spread it to edges.
- Broil, about 4 inches from heat, until cheese is melted and lightly browned. 3 to 5 minutes. Serves 4, 2 muffin halves each.
- To save time, you can make the filling ahead, then spread and broil the muffins in the morning. This is also good with a slice of ham on the bun before you spread the egg mixture.
